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
123075810 2078 80 1856212 30140566286
9259399332 136561
9259399332 136561
497989220 991402175 79272 92242
All about undefined
Interested in learning more?
9259399332 136561
497989220 991402175 79272 92242
See more
06368124397 618843731
0806 032575026 797 46
See more
6901859 6525714997 805904451
0666106 408 411198 132024549
See more